KPMG commissioned Woods Bagot to design the 26,000m2 interior fitout having made the decision to take up a lease in the new King Street Wharf development at Site 6 which was a part of the larger King Street Wharf development by the Australand/Multiplex joint venture. Design and documentation had to be completed within an extremely tight timeframe to meet contractual obligations between KPMG and the developer. The interior fitout was completed in an integrated manner concurrently with the base building construction. The project commenced with an intense briefing period where Woods Bagot undertook a series of meetings with representatives from KPMG to allow the development of a flexible and consistent planning solution. Information from the client, stakeholders and staff members ensured the base building and integrated fitout met all requirements. A key driver of the solution was to provide for flexible and adaptable office fitout, including a more efficient, open work environment with reduced churn costs. The process reviewed workspace standards and determined a consistent and revised range of space standards for universal application across KPMG. As part of the review of workspace standards Woods Bagot were able to introduce a flexible, common, multipurpose work area to each floor to satisfy an identified need for collaborative work. Adjacent to this multipurpose area, staff breakout areas are located centrally to each floor adjacent to the lift core to encourage interface and communication amongst staff. The fitout comprises three main zones - ground floor with private auditorium and prefunction space; typical floors (levels 2-14) with a mix of offices and open work areas; and executive and reception floor (level 15) with a mix of catered meeting rooms lounges enjoying spectacular harbour views.
